Montjournal
Montjournal is a peak in Ferrières-Saint-Mary, Arrondissement of Saint-Flour,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es and has an elevation of 1,180 metres. Montjournal is situated nearby to the hamlet Lusclade, as well as near Labro.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Peak with an elevation of 1,180 metres
- Description: mountain in France
- Also known as: “Mont Journal”
